Control of Modern Integrated Power Systems
Springer London Ltd (Verlag)
978-1-4471-1252-5 (ISBN)
1. Computer System for Power System Operation and Control.- 1.1 Computer Control of Power Systems.- 1.2 Functions, Computer Configurations and Control aids.- 1.3 Case Studies of Computerisation in Control Centres.- 2. System control.- 2.1 Economic Load Dispatch for Thermal Power Plants.- 2.2 Load-Frequency Control (LFC).- 2.3 Automatic Generation Control (AGC).- 3. Reactive power balance and voltage control.- 3.1 General.- 3.2 Reactive Power Planning and Control Boundaries.- 3.3 Reactive Power Requirements.- 3.4 Reactive Power Balance — Case Study.- 3.5 Reactive Generation and Absorption.- 3.6 Two Case Studies.- 3.7 Reactive Scheduling Procedure.- 3.8 Operating Measures.- 3.9 Modern Trends in Voltage Regulation.- 4. System Security and Quality of Operation.- 4.1 General.- 4.2 Definitions of Operating States, Voltage and Frequency Collapse, Electromagnetic Compatibility and Security Despatch.- 4.3 Security Monitoring.- 4.4 Quality of Operation.- 4.5 Effective Network Utilisation.- 4.6 Sources of Disturbances.- 5. Emergency Control.- 5.1 General.- 5.2 Measures to Prevent Frequency Collapse.- 5.3 Measures to Prevent Voltage Collapse.- 5.4 Prevention of Overloads and Instability.- 5.5 Prevention of Power Disparity.- 5.6 Operation of Generators in Emergency Conditions.- 5.7 Restoration Procedures.- 6. Grid Failures — Case Studies and ‘Defence’ Plan Against Failures.- 6.1 General.- 6.2 Case Studies.- 6.3 EDF’s ‘Defence’ Plan Against Major Disturbances..- 7. Effects of Grid Disturbances on Power Station and Consumer Equipment.- 7.1 General.- 7.2 Effects of Low Frequency Operation on Power Station Equipment.- 7.3 Effects of Low Frequency Operation on System Load.- 7.4 High — Frequency Operation During Light Load Periods.- Appendix 1: Dispatching and ControlFunctions at Various Levels.- Appendix 2.- Operating Principles of North American Electric Reliability Council (NERC).- Most Common Terms Used in Power System Operation.
